What to do about a leaky turbo unit? S40-V40

I've just come to find out that I have a leaky turbo which is causing coolant loss and a slow rate....

What can I do about this? It's probably the seals on it or something? Can it be serviced, or is it a whole-unit kind of swap. If it's a swap, I imagine it's quite an expensive part or job? Any DYI solutions?

    What to do about a leaky turbo unit? S40-V40

    Usually it is the seal on the coolant pipe that goes into the turbo. Working upside down and backwards is the only real challenge.

    What to do about a leaky turbo unit? S40-V40

    They sell kits to rebuilt the turbos, you tube is your best friend here.

    You can buy another turbo and replace yours but check the leak first it might be the coolant line or hose and not the turbo.

    Many years ago when I had a 760, I had the turbo rebuilt by a place that did only large diesel trucks, the guy said it was a piece of cake.
